Sinfonia in G major

Featured Replies

This is great!  The only comment I have about it is that it seems to be in 3/4 rather than 6/8.  The rhythmic identity of your motive is in duple rather than triple time.  It starts on beat 3 (beat 2 in 3/4) which is an off-beat in 6/8 (and given the slurry of consecutive 16th notes doesn't sound like a pick-up but instead accents that beat).  If you look at the whole rest of the sinfonia, there are many places that put an emphasis on beats that are off-beats in 6/8 but on the beat in 3/4 which contribute to this feeling.  Great job though.  The motive is long and has it's own characteristic identity that's memorable.  Thanks for sharing!

On 3/4/2022 at 1:56 AM, Jerry Engelbach said:

Why did you call it a Sinfonia? It's a fugue.

 

Basically it's not a well developed fugue with defined episodes and entries. It's light and uses mostly free counterpoint. Hence I thought considering it a 3 voiced invention (that is, 'Sinfonia') would be more apt. Thanks for listening
